For non-radiused horizontal bends, simply cut one side out of the adjoining cable tray wire and lay one cable tray on top of the other so they can be connected using the horizontal flex splice kit (Pa...
The example to the right shows the cutting pattern that would be used to create a 30 Degree Bend on 12″ Wide Wire Cable Tray. To make a tighter radius, only leave one row in between

Easy step to making cable tray offset bend 30 degrees at a distance of 150 mm +150 mm = 300mm. 30 degree cutting Formula 50 mm cable tray 30 × 0.44 = 13 mm. (13mm by 13mm) cutting.
